You Have:
15+ years of experience supporting cryptologic operations or cryptology within a Fleet or Navy Information Warfare mission area
Experience supporting operational planning, readiness assessments, concept development, doctrine, tactics, techniques, and procedures
Experience with exercise scenario development, operational planning, and basic wargaming scenarios.
Experience with JWICS and Net national databases for operational research and to improve tactical scenario development for Master Scenario Event Lists (MSELs)
Experience with afloat cryptologic or recent operational deployment with SSEE Increment F NEC C21A
Knowledge of latest Navy Live, Virtual, Constructive (LVC) methods, processes, techniques, and procedures, to include C2 organization, unit employment, capabilities and limitations, integration, and threat capabilities
Knowledge of the integration of cryptology with other Information Warfare disciplines, including the training and mentoring of senior officers and senior enlisted Sailors within Ships Signals Exploitation Spaces (SSES), Supplementary Plot (SUPPLOT), Expeditionary Plot (EXPLOT), and guidance to Afloat Cryptologic Managers
Ability to travel up to 15% of the time
TS/SCI clearance
HS diploma or GED
Nice If You Have:
Experience as instructor in formal Navy training environment or Navy Instructor NEC 805A including legacy 9502
Experience with Joint Semi-Automated Forces (JSAF), STALLION, or other modeling tools within Navy Continuous Training Environment (NCTE) NTB
